To experience snow and the calming breeze of summer, Wildflower Hall, a part of the Oberoi collection, is the perfect choice to romance with nature. The former residence of Lord Kitchener, this stay exudes grand ambience with a welcoming lounge, a snooker and billiards room, an impressively stocked library and opulent accommodation. Dine with nature with their al-fresco dining and outdoor settings, and customized spa facilities in wooded locations – making this trip a luxurious one.
The Taara House is nestled within pine trees and is a token of love from the family that resides there. Designed in the most classic and yet modernized style – made from recycled wood and consisting of a glass house made for dining under the stars or sunbathing on a warm sunny day. The use of Burma Teak, Pine and Oak can be spotted throughout the residency. The fine art collection and Scandinavian light fixtures are some highlights of this house.
Another Himalayan stay is the Chonor House located away from the hustle bustle of the city and yet walking distance away from the markets, and culture. This property was made to blend in with the natural environment overlooking the Kangra valley. The Tibetan theme follows this property. It is a perfect blend to experience the calm and serenity as well as the Tibetan values and practices here. You can take an art tour or visit the Norbulingka Institute here.

Rakkh is an all-inclusive family owned resort in Dharamshala. This place not only defines family living but the activities provided give you a feel of the culture and bonding experiences, unlike any other stay. Right from short picnics, treks within nature, in-house games, maggie and juice stations, pottery and pizza making sessions, sky-cycling, wall climbing, mountain biking, Himachali weaving and partaking in the cuisine and indulging in the most authentic Rasoi – the list of activities and experiences are endless and very homely!
Taj Theog Resort and Spa is surrounded by pristine mountains and large acres of forests. It overlooks the Western Himalayan Valley views. The architecture oozes colonial charm and regionality, paying respects to the local craftsmens. All the rooms offer views of snow-capped peaks and deodar forests. The surroundings make it possible for experiences such as skiing in Narkanda, golfing in Naldehra Golf Course, go on short treks and dine under the stars to take place.

Elgin Hall, a summer retreat for the British royal family, is one of the best homestays in Dalhousie. The property is a tranquil and boutique stay for every individual. This retreat narrates the tale of the former British Empire. Each room is painted in soft pastel shades, and sharp white furniture inspired by the Victorian era. It holds 125 years of preserved heritage and European-inspired elements and rooms such as a tea lounge, a library, a game room, and sumptuous cuisines!
